Summary

This host is running XM Easy Personal FTP Server and is prone to Denial of Service vulnerability.

Insight

Insight

The flaws are due to, - An error when processing directory listing FTP requests. This can be exploited to terminate the FTP service via overly large 'LIST' or 'NLST' requests. - An error when handling certain FTP requests. By sending a specially- crafted request to the APPE or DELE commands, a remote authenticated attacker could cause the server to stop responding.

Affected Software

Affected Software

Dxmsoft, XM Easy Personal FTP Server version 5.8.0 and prior.
